Output 5e3f890fc1244c30ec5e755b30e77115fb21903db43cce613845c3682070442e:16

value
650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9fb359b14aab05b684ed5d06206ee0fbbb24cbb OP_EQUAL
address
3MZbVWJ5o6NgUfFoqrbvy9ungWX1jtetWp
transaction
5e3f890fc1244c30ec5e755b30e77115fb21903db43cce613845c3682070442e
spent
true